Respiratory therapists are professionals that assist people with cardiopulmonary illness, problems or disorders, it comprehend heart and lungs.

To become a respiratory therapists, it's needed an associate's degree, if the person wants to pursue higher positions, he/she must obtains a master's degree. In addition, an associate's degree is a two-years post-secondary degree, people in this professional path must curse study at least two full time years . In other words, an associate's degree is like the first two years of a bachelor degree.

In addition, there are certifications and credentials to practice respiratory therapies, The Certified Respiratory Therapist Credential (CRT) and The Registered Respiratory Therapist Credential (RRT), these two are the acceptable credentials. CRT is like the first level, the person must already completed a program, and RRT is like the second level, people can apply to this if the already have the CRT.
